Coin collecting is a rewarding hobby for those who appreciate history, organizing exceptional pieces, comparing standards, and at times, discovering that personal items may hold a surprisingly high value. If you have a jar containing old coins that have not been examined for many years, this Introduction to Coin Collecting may be the ideal opportunity for taking your first step as a numismatist! This class is for true beginners as well as those who may wish to better evaluate and organize coins they have owned for many years.

Jack Lawrence is long-time coin collector who has offered school programs for area students and individuals.
